The USS Cairo was an Excelsior-class Federation starship in service in the 24th century, named after the Egyptian capital.

In 2369, it was under the command of Captain Edward Jellico, who was temporarily transferred to command the USS Enterprise-D for a special diplomatic mission to the Cardassian border. (TNG: "Chain of Command, Part I") The Cairo was deployed to defend the Federation system Minos Korva when it was threatened by a potential Cardassian attack. Following the peaceful conclusion of the crisis, Captain Jellico returned to his command on the Cairo. (TNG: "Chain of Command, Part II")

During the Dominion War, the Cairo was commanded by Captain Leslie Wong, and assigned to patrol the Romulan Neutral Zone in 2374. The ship was believed to have been ambushed and destroyed by Dominion forces who had crossed Romulan space. (DS9: "In the Pale Moonlight")

The Star Trek Encyclopedia says in its shiplist that the Cairo was the Excelsior-class vessel seen in TNG: "Preemptive Strike", though this may have been the Gorkon.
The registry of the USS Cairo was given in the Star Trek Encyclopedia as NCC-42136.
